CVS CVS pharmacy HIPAA violation

I believe that CVS regularly breaks HIPAA laws by reading out prescription names over its microphone in their drive through. I've complained countless times to corporate and nothing has changed. They should do what Riteaide does. Simply ask how many prescriptions are being picked up and leave it to the customer to ask about any medications by name. A reporter could do a great news spot on this. Take a camera through the drive through and video record the employees saying drug names through the microphone. The rest of the drive through may hear this sensitive information, and any other passengers in the car receiving the prescription. CVS needs to train their pharmacy employees, however I've had actual pharmacists at CVS name my meds out loud and they should know better. Shame on them. This has never happened to me at the other pharmacies I frequent. I called in January and February of 2021 and told CVS corporate to get their district managers on this issue. Since then, I've had only one time when my private information was kept private by their employees. If I'm wrong, and this is not a HIPPA issue, it certainly should be. I prefer a pharmacy that takes the utmost care and caution with all of my health information, in every capacity, at all times.
